Output 2807feebdaa1d1ce6ce0cab2eac48e9838c7f5c96b17090ce79ef14fcaa32619:0

value
316958551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d71ee1378efd426f21aad0bcef6a658b62a50088 OP_EQUAL
address
MTWcWEgM5HVHRJQ2aNCBUkEYH8dNY16Zds
transaction
2807feebdaa1d1ce6ce0cab2eac48e9838c7f5c96b17090ce79ef14fcaa32619
spent
true